No, too much power blows speakers, either from over-excursion or from exceeding the thermal rating. Clipping (i.e. distortion) at low power levels does no harm. Clipping at high power levels will cause more power to be delivered to the speaker. Clipping a 100W amp into a 400W speaker system is unlikely to cause damage.

With PA amps and speakers, it's generally considered just fine to run 1.5 to 2 times, or even 2.5 times as much power as what the speakers are rated for. As long as you're not pushing the amps to clipping, a good speker system (as your ampeg is a good speaker system) can handle it. There's no reason a bass amp and bass cabs won't comply to the same general rules of thumb. I'm not going to get into exactly what causes blown speakers on this forum. There are people here who know much more about it than I. But headroom is a good thing. Playing real music, rather than test tones, your amp is rarely going to be putting out anywhere near it's maximum wattage, and then only for very short peaks. This amp has enough juice that even on the louder peaks of your playing, it's not likely to distort.
Bottom line, running a 1250 watt amp into a speaker rated at 600 watts is just fine unless you're pushing the amp really hard. And long before you push this amp that hard, Bundy is going to tell you to turn it down because he can't hear his guitar. :p
